INACTIVES: Lions at Cowboys

ARLINGTON, Texas – The Detroit Lions are the healthiest they've been all season with not one player on the active roster carrying an injury designation on Friday's injury report into today's matchup with the Dallas Cowboys at AT&T Stadium.

It's only healthy scratches for the Lions today, and that list includes safety Loren Strickland, edge rusher James Houston, wide receiver Isaiah Williams, offensive lineman Colby Sorsdal and tackle Giovanni Manu.

Detroit elevated defensive lineman Isaac Ukwu from the practice squad for this game and the undrafted rookie out of Ole Miss will make his NFL debut as the Lions continue to try to find production opposite Aidan Hutchinson on the edge of their defensive line. Ukwu had a sack in each of Detroit's three preseason games.

The only injury concern the Lions had this week is when safety Kerby Joseph injured a hamstring in practice Thursday and was listed as limited. Joseph was back at practice Friday as a full participant and didn't carry a designation into today's contest. Detroit's bye Week 5 really put them in a good spot from an injury perspective for today's key NFC matchup.
